Chiefs Sign Former Bills Cornerback Kaiir Elam

The Kansas City Chiefs have signed former Buffalo Bills cornerback Kaiir Elam to address their need for depth in the secondary. This move comes after trading away Trent McDuffie and losing Jaylen Watson, signaling a significant revamp of th...

Key Insights

  • Kaiir Elam, a former first-round pick, joins the Chiefs after stints with the Bills, Cowboys, and Titans.
  • Elam's career has yet to live up to his draft potential, but the Chiefs hope to revitalize his performance under defensive coordinator Steve Spagnuolo.
  • The Chiefs traded Trent McDuffie to the Los Angeles Rams and lost Jaylen Watson, creating a need for cornerback reinforcements.
  • Elam has started 19 games in his career, recording two interceptions and eight passes defended.
  • The current projected starting cornerbacks for the Chiefs are Nohl Williams and Kristian Fulton.

In-Depth Analysis

The Kansas City Chiefs have been proactive in reshaping their cornerback position. After trading Trent McDuffie to the Los Angeles Rams for draft picks and seeing Jaylen Watson depart, the Chiefs needed to add talent and experience to their secondary.

Kaiir Elam, drafted by the Buffalo Bills in the first round of the 2022 NFL Draft, never quite found his footing in Buffalo. After being traded to the Dallas Cowboys and subsequently spending time with the Tennessee Titans, Elam is looking for a fresh start in Kansas City. Despite his struggles, Elam possesses the physical tools and potential that made him a high draft pick.

Elam's strengths include his size (6'1") and speed (4.39 40-yard dash), which are ideal for playing outside cornerback. If Steve Spagnuolo and the Chiefs' coaching staff can unlock Elam's potential, he could become a valuable asset. He will be competing with Nohl Williams, Kristian Fulton, and other defensive backs for playing time.

The Chiefs' cornerback situation remains a work in progress. The addition of Elam provides depth and competition, but the team may also look to add further talent through the upcoming NFL Draft.
